| Index: services/view_manager/view_manager_service_impl.cc
|
| diff --git a/services/view_manager/view_manager_service_impl.cc b/services/view_manager/view_manager_service_impl.cc
|
| index 2ed0193e8e9d5348a044fb14e62aa94bd2bced24..e2f1bee6a642eea457a91b2a34a63538f576e20c 100644
|
| --- a/services/view_manager/view_manager_service_impl.cc
|
| +++ b/services/view_manager/view_manager_service_impl.cc
|
| @@ -175,6 +175,17 @@ void ViewManagerServiceImpl::ProcessViewBoundsChanged(
|
| Rect::From(new_bounds));
|
| }
|
|
|
| +void ViewManagerServiceImpl::ProcessViewportMetricsChanged(
|
| + const ServerView* view,
|
| + const mojo::ViewportMetrics& old_metrics,
|
| + const mojo::ViewportMetrics& new_metrics,
|
| + bool originated_change) {
|
| + if (!root())
|
| + return;
|
| + client()->OnViewViewportMetricsChanged(
|
| + ViewIdToTransportId(*root()), old_metrics.Clone(), new_metrics.Clone());
|
| +}
|
| +
|
| void ViewManagerServiceImpl::ProcessWillChangeViewHierarchy(
|
| const ServerView* view,
|
| const ServerView* new_parent,
|
|
|